Yes, that's why I'm still having trouble to understand the fuss about VFS abstraction as used in 9p etc ;-). I've always been glad to know when I was not on an NFS or sshfs mount (mostly for reasons that you can't design away, i.e. network reliability issues). So why bother abstracting out that knowledge even more?
When you come at it from the perspective that remote resources are the norm, and you assemble a computer from resources scattered across the network, local access becomes weird special case. Generally, you're running a file server and terminal as separate nodes, with an auth server somewhere else.

And if you're actually using the knowledge that some files are local, you get bugs and assumptions creep in, and now your software stops working in the case where you're running on someone else's network.

It's about transparently providing the same interface to everyone, and making that interface simple enough that implementing it is easy enough that it's actually done, and the interface actually gets used.

Then, if you want to interpose, remap, analyze, manipulate, redirect, or sandbox it, you can do that without much trouble. The special cases are rare and can be reasoned about.

Reasoning about your system in full frees you to do a huge amount.
